Southeastern Career Center Welcomes New Principal

The SCC serves 11 schools districts.

Jeff Cox. Photo by SCC.

(Versailles, Ind.) - Jeff Cox has been added to the leadership team at the Southeastern Career Center in Versailles. 

Cox has been named the new principal. 

According to the SCC, Cox brings a passion for Career Technical Education, a strong background in CTE, deep commitment to student success, and belief in the power of hands-on, career-focused learning.

"Jeff cares deeply about students, values collaboration, and will play a key role in supporting both our staff and our mission to prepare students for bright futures," reads a statement from SCC. 

The SCC serves 11 school districts, offering 15 programs and 101 industry partners.
